On Windows 10, how can I quickly find and focus an already running application (by window name), across virtual desktops ?
Say I have 6 virtual desktops, if I'm on desktop #6 and Chrome Gmail is running on desktop #2 I'd like to quickly (2-3 keystrokes) find & switch to that Gmail tab, wherever else I am on my desktops.
Typically, I often have 6+ virtual desktops, with perhaps 5-10 windows on each. I'm visually impaired (brain damage), so I tend to avoid having to "look at things" and visually search for stuff (too many times things "hide in plain sight" in my case ;-P). I much rather prefer to type a few letters to find an exact match or use key bindings.
